The "Medically Needy" program in Florida includes those who make slightly too much money for Medicaid (particularly including those on Social Security Disability Income), however do not make enough money to cover their medical bills and general living expenses.
Go to this link for Florida Medicaid Fact sheet, pg 11 explains medically needy share of cost calculation. http://www.dcf.state.fl.us/programs/access/docs/fammedfactsheet.pdf
